Ingredients

4 lean beef schnitzel
1 tablespoon prepared mustard
4 -8 spinach leaves or 4 silver beet leaves
1 cup grated apple ( leave the skin on )
fresh ground black pepper
1/2 cup water
1 teaspoon cornflour
1/2 teaspoon prepared mustard

Instructions

1.Preheat oven to 200 degrees Celsius.
2.Place each beef schnitzel between two pieces of cling film and use a rolling pin to even out and widen.
3.Brush mustard onto each side of the schnitzel.
4.Place spinach leaves or silver beet leaves onto the schnitzels, leaving a small border, then sprinkle with grated apple and black pepper.
5.Roll up schnitzels tightly and secure with toothpicks.
6.Place beef rolls in a baking dish, sprinkle with black pepper, and add water to the dish.
7.Cover with foil and bake for 25 minutes, then remove the foil and bake for a further 10-15 minutes until cooked.

HEALTH & BENEFITS

Beef is an excellent source of protein, which is essential for building and repairing muscle tissue.
Spinach and silver beet are high in vitamins and minerals, such as vitamin A, vitamin C, iron, and potassium.
Apples are a good source of fiber and vitamin C.
